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3621 778363 63162
8138313089 478 315504324
8138313089 478 315504324
0498729 54 261324
All about undefined
Interested in learning more?
8138313089 478 315504324
0498729 54 261324
See more
915999460 609610 4400864
25697 138 55 46350335 5231658652
See more
68729200072 356
010142 53708696326 644
See more